Schools Closed In Noida, Ghaziabad On September 3 Due To Heavy Rainfall; Check Update For Delhi News24 –


In view of continuous rainfall, all schools in Gautam Buddha Nagar and Ghaziabad will remain closed on Wednesday, September 3, 2025. The Ghaziabad district administration has announced the closure of both government and private schools. The decision has been taken to ensure the safety of students, teachers, and staff members. Heavy rains lashed Ghaziabad and Noida on Tuesday, with the India Meteorological Department (IMD) issuing a yellow alert for both the districts.

The official order, issued under the direction of Ghaziabad District Magistrate Ravindra Kumar Mandar, and enforced by Basic Shiksha Adhikari (BSA) O.P. Yadav states that all the schools and colleges will remain closed on September 3.

“In view of the extremely heavy rainfall in Ghaziabad and to ensure the safety of students, a holiday has been declared for all educational institutions up to Class 12 on September 3, 2025. Strict compliance with this order is mandatory,” the directive stated.

Schools Closed In Noida

Similarly, the Gautam Buddha Nagar district administration has also ordered the closure of schools, as the district remained under yellow alert on Tuesday, September 2. Schools in Noida and Greater Noida will remain closed tomorrow i.e. Wednesday, September 3. The order has been issued under directive of District Magistrate Medha Roopam, enforced by the District Basic Education Officer Rahul Panwar.
